COleClientItem::SetHostNames
Llame a esta función para especificar el nombre de la aplicación contenedora y el nombre de contenedor para un elemento OLE incrustado.
void SetHostNames(
LPCTSTR lpszHost,
LPCTSTR lpszHostObj
);
Parámetros
lpszHost
Puntero al nombre usuario- visible de la aplicación contenedora.lpszHostObj
Puntero a una cadena de identificación del contenedor que contiene el elemento.
Comentarios
Si la aplicación servidor se escribió utilizando la biblioteca Microsoft Foundation Class, esta función se llama a la función miembro de OnSetHostNames de documento de COleServerDoc que contiene el elemento OLE.Esta información se utiliza en títulos de la ventana cuando se edita el elemento.Cada vez que un documento contenedor cargado, el marco de trabajo llama a esta función para todos los elementos de OLE en el documento.SetHostNames sólo es aplicable a los elementos incrustados.No es necesario llamar a esta función cada vez que un elemento OLE incrustado se provoca para editar.
También se denomina automáticamente con el nombre de aplicación y el nombre del documento cuando un objeto se carga o cuando un archivo se guarda con un nombre diferente.En consecuencia, normalmente no es necesario llamar a esta función directamente.
Para obtener más información, vea IOleObject::SetHostNames en Windows SDK.
Requisitos
encabezado: afxole.h